Pros:
|
Construction, Fitment, Performance, Price
|
|
Cons:
|
Tranny bracket is a bit of a bugger to install
|
|
GREAT lookin' piece that impresses and performs as well. Nice sound, nice performance - what else could you ask for?
(Note: Anti-seize the tranny bracket and exhaust doughnut joint to prevent squeaks and it will be noise-free)

Pros:
|
a very pretty piece, solid construction.
|
|
Cons:
|
some what louder spool up noise
|
|
Definate improvement inthrotle respone and power. a good looking unit but I wrapped it in header tape any ways. I should mention some people feel that the pipe should be segmented with a short seperate chamber for the wast gate but I have no direct experiance there.
